Explore groundbreaking research on Greenland's ice melt dynamics in this 37-minute press conference from the American Geophysical Union's Fall Meeting 2014. Discover surprising findings that challenge previous assumptions about glacial melting patterns and their implications for global sea level rise. Gain insights into cutting-edge scientific methodologies used to study ice sheet behavior and learn how these new discoveries may impact climate change predictions and coastal management strategies.
